Both of our daughters have quick wit and are spontaneous with humor. During their childhood, we were a family of Christian magicians and evangelists. It was an honor to entertain at all kinds of events. We performed at Reunions, Promotions; Scouts; Churches; Company Events; Conferences; and Magic Conventions in many States and Provinces.

Our Girls, Leona and Lynnette, were phenomenal little entertainers for their age. They were amazing Illusionists, superior at Scripture retention, sang beautiful solos, and more. It was an honor to lecture, and teach others how we did illusion programs as a family to present Biblical Truth. Their mom and my wife, Dottie perfected misdirection, chalk art, comedy, and more. The girls would enter the talent shows and we performed as a family on the main stage at many conferences and conventions. Both girls worked with our doves, rabbit, colorful scarves, flowers, coins, multiplying billiard balls and more. It was quite the performance and when my wife and daughters came onto the stage, I think I could have produced an elephant because no one was looking at me. All eyes were on the girls. What a privilege it was to perform as a family with some outstanding professional magicians in the audience. 

One day at The Fellowship of Christian Magician’s Convention in Winona Lake Indiana, we attended a lecture on coin manipulation. Rev. Bill Baker (The Magician) was the presenter. It looked like he was pulling coins out of the air (a church treasurer dream). He was demonstrating a trick called the Miser’s Dream. During the lecture, he pretended to throw a silver dollar toward our daughter Leona, and asked her if she caught it.  She yelled, “I sure did.” Without missing a beat, she reached into her pocket and pulled out a silver dollar that she showed to everyone attending the lecture. Our girls consistently amazed people with their quick wit.

Today, Leona is an Education Professional teaching teachers how to be better teachers. She is a mom of two children and the wife of a Godly man. Her entire family are actively involved in ministry and in their churches. Leona and Lynnette remain very witty and quite remarkable.
